The Ladders for Leaders program offers outstanding high school and college students the opportunity to participate in paid 6-week summer internships with leading corporations, non-profit organizations, and government agencies in New York City. Ladders for Leaders is open to NYC students ages 16—24, enrolled in high school or college. There is no GPA requirement for participants to apply for Ladder for Leaders.

PENCIL will host pre-employment training sessions for accepted students. Students are expected to complete up to 20 hours of training, including a minimum of 7 hours of in person training, before they are eligible for placement in an internship. PENCIL holds multiple training sessions throughout the spring semester during NYC Department of Education Mid-Winter Recess, as well as additional dates throughout the Spring.
Training information will be shared once accepted.
Students who completed training in a previous year but were not placed in a Ladders for Leaders internship, must attend training again this year.

PENCIL supports a cohort of students engaged in a paid work-based learning experience designed to promote career awareness, exploration and preparation. Career Explorers takes place over a six-week period from July 1st to August 9th. Students complete 25 hours of synchronous and asynchronous activities each week and are paid $16 per hour.

All PENCIL internships provide students with at least 150 hours of work in July and August and are paid at a NY State minimum wage or higher. Students are matched to employers based on alignment of skills and interests, however, internship placement is not guaranteed.
